
Worked on the electricitymaps-contrib repository to deliver a major enhancement to the US-MIDA-PJM data parser, focusing on improving data integrity and maintainability. Refactored the parser to adopt an event-driven approach using event classes, which streamlined data handling and improved the robustness of ingestion pipelines. Standardized all timestamps to UTC and updated timezone configuration to better align with production data streams, addressing challenges in timezone handling and data consistency. Leveraged Python and YAML for API integration, configuration management, and data parsing, laying the groundwork for future enhancements while ensuring more reliable retrieval of production, consumption, and price datasets for analytics.
